Description
Transcription for solo alto saxophone and wind band Written in 1970, Robert Muczynski's two-movement "Sonata for Alto Saxophone and Piano" has become a standard in the saxophone repertoire. Anthony LaBounty has skillfully adapted this work for wind band accompaniment, carefully preserving the intent and style of the original with its unique blend of modern tonalities and syncopated rhythmic drive.

Why we love this

LaBounty's arrangement respects Muczynski's compositional voice entirely, translating the sonata's modern harmonic language and rhythmic sophistication into wind band textures rather than simply orchestrating around the soloist. The result is a rare transcription where every instrumental section contributes meaningfully to the musical conversation, making this equally rewarding for your ensemble to play as it is for your saxophonist to perform.

What to expect

Modern yet approachable, with angular harmonic twists that never stray into obscurity. The syncopated rhythmic drive gives the piece contemporary energy while Muczynski's melodic gift keeps everything grounded in genuine expression rather than technical display.

Who it's for

Concert bands at the Grade 5 level looking to feature a strong alto saxophonist within a substantive chamber work. Directors seeking standard repertoire that expands beyond typical wind band fare will find this a genuine asset to their programming toolkit.

How to get the most out of it

  • Establish clear communication with your alto saxophonist about the balance point between soloist and ensemble; Muczynski's writing demands that the band support rather than overwhelm, so sectional dynamics matter as much as the featured part.
  • Pay attention to the syncopated rhythmic figures in the accompaniment. These aren't merely accompaniment patterns but integral melodic components that give the arrangement its forward momentum and modern edge.
  • Shape the two movements as distinct entities. The contrasting moods require different ensemble colors and articulative approaches, so rehearse them with clear tonal and textural goals in mind.
